• Domingo 15 de Diciembre de 2024, 12:26

Autor Tema:  problemilla con else  (Leído 1512 veces)

eruelas

  • Miembro activo
  • **
  • Mensajes: 69
  • Nacionalidad: mx
    • Ver Perfil
problemilla con else
« en: Viernes 29 de Agosto de 2008, 19:11 »
0
no c k es lo k este mal solo diganme en k falla no me hagan el programa grx de antemano
Código: Text
  1. /*Ruelas Olea Edgar Adan
  2. PLE II*/
  3. #include<conio.h>
  4. #include<stdio.h>
  5. int a,b;
  6. void divisible();
  7. void main()
  8. {
  9.     clrscr();
  10.     divisible();
  11. }
  12. void divisible()
  13. {
  14.     printf("Introduce los numeros a dividir: ");
  15.     scanf("%i",&a,b);
  16.     if
  17.  
  18.     (a%b==0);
  19.     printf("El numero es divisible");
  20.  
  21.     else if
  22.     printf("El numero no es divisible");
  23.     getch();
  24. }
  25.  
  26.  
  27.  

Eternal Idol

  • Moderador
  • ******
  • Mensajes: 4696
  • Nacionalidad: ar
    • Ver Perfil
Re: problemilla con else
« Respuesta #1 en: Viernes 29 de Agosto de 2008, 19:56 »
0
if
 
     (a%b==0);

Nacional y Popular En mi país la bandera de Eva es inmortal.


Queremos una Argentina socialmente justa, económicamente libre y  políticamente soberana.
¡Perón cumple, Evita dignifica!


La mano invisible del mercado me robo la billetera.

ProfesorX

  • Moderador
  • ******
  • Mensajes: 796
  • Nacionalidad: mx
    • Ver Perfil
Re: problemilla con else
« Respuesta #2 en: Viernes 29 de Agosto de 2008, 20:06 »
0
Aparte del punto y coma que menciona EI, tambien esta mal el "else if" solo debes poner "else" quita el if despues de else

NOTA:
==================================================================
Este foro es para ayudar, aprender, compartir... usenlo para eso,
NO SE RESUELVEN DUDAS POR MENSAJE PRIVADO Y MENOS POR CORREO
==================================================================

eruelas

  • Miembro activo
  • **
  • Mensajes: 69
  • Nacionalidad: mx
    • Ver Perfil
Re: problemilla con else
« Respuesta #3 en: Viernes 29 de Agosto de 2008, 20:36 »
0
muchas gracias por su ayuda no rekordaba k el if no lleva ; jejej gracias tmbn por lo del else if ya esta terminado graciaaaaaaaaSSSSS!!!!!!!!

rfog

  • Miembro MUY activo
  • ***
  • Mensajes: 166
    • Ver Perfil
Re: problemilla con else
« Respuesta #4 en: Sábado 30 de Agosto de 2008, 10:46 »
0
También se os olivdó

scanf("%i",&a,b);

que debería ser

scanf("%i %i",&a,&b);

para que coja DOS enteros.

PS: Je, je, qué curioso, desde que aprendí C no he vuelto a usar esa función. :-)
Microsoft Visual C++ MVP - Mi blog sobre programación: http://geeks.ms/blogs/rfog